Abstract

Two new interacting particle systems are introduced in this paper: dynamic versions of the asymmetric inclusion process (ASIP) and the asymmetric Brownian energy process (ABEP). Dualities and reversibility of these processes are proven, where the quantum algebra Uq(su(1,1)) and the Al-Salam–Chihara polynomials play a crucial role. Two hierarchies of duality functions are found, where the Askey-Wilson polynomials and Jacobi polynomials sit on top.
